Handover note — Crumbwheel order cutoffs.

Welcome aboard. The bakery cutoff rule in Crumbwheel closes same-day orders at 14:00 local to each storefront, not UTC — this has bitten us twice. Holiday overrides live in the calendar service and take precedence silently, so always check there first when a cutoff looks wrong. To unlock the calendar service's admin console after a restart, enter the recovery passphrase below.

vault phrase of bagap-bahaf = silion-pelox-sorox-casdor-quenwyn-fraax-eliox-praael-kelion-quenvan-kasox-rusael-norius-belvan

Subject: Receipt mailer cut-over complete

Hi Priya — summarizing last night's cut-over of the Almsgate donation-receipt mailer for your review. We drained the legacy queue at 01:20, replayed the 214 held receipts through the new renderer, and confirmed template parity on a sampled set. Bounce handling now routes through the new suppression list, and the old sender was decommissioned this morning. No duplicates were observed. For your review of the diff, the production settings the new mailer runs with are included below.

settings of kagag-kagef:
[kelath]
port = 9300
region = west-4
host = kelath.olvarqworks.example
team = sorion
timeout_ms = 1000
retries = 8

## 3.7.2 — InvoPress PDF Renderer

- Fixed glyph fallback crash on mixed-script line items.
- Totals footer no longer clipped at A5 page size.
- Render queue now retries once on font-cache miss instead of failing the batch.
- Deprecated the legacy watermark flag; removal in 3.9.

Rollback: redeploy 3.7.1 image, flush the render cache, replay the dead-letter queue. If pages render blank after rollback, page the module owner directly.

named custodian: Belius Casath Ulaix Sorius

# Client setup for the Driftnet orphan sweeper.
# Connects to the internal Vaultline API and enumerates
# resources with no owning deployment, then queues deletions.
# Run only from the release host; concurrency is not supported.
# Results land in the sweep-log bucket for audit.
# Authenticate with the sweeper service key, which follows.

gateway credential: kto23_LX9A4ys6i4nzHtpOLNLodKK